MENA Weekly Roundup: Iraq Partners with Total, QatarEnergy for 1.25 GW Solar Project

The Iraqi Ministry of Oil signed an agreement with TotalEnergies and QatarEnergy to develop a 1.25 GW solar project as part of the Gas Growth Integrated Project in the country’s Basra region. Both companies would equally own the project, and it will consist of two million bifacial solar panels mounted on single-axis trackers to be installed in five 250 MW phases to come online between 2025 and 2027. Once completely operational, the solar project is expected to generate up to 1.25 GW of energy. The project will supply clean energy to approximately 350,000 homes in southern Iraq.
